In this landmark book the renowned scholar of religion Mircea Eliade lays the groundwork for a Western understanding of Yoga, exploring how its guiding principle, that of freedom, involves remaining in the world without letting oneself be exhausted by such "conditionings" as time and history. Drawing on years of study and experience in India, Eliade provides a comprehensive survey of Yoga in theory and practice from its earliest foreshadowings in the Vedas through the twentieth century. The subjects discussed include Patajali, author of the Yoga-sutras; yogic techniques, such as concentration "on a Single Point," postures, and respiratory discipline; and Yoga in relation to Brahmanism, Buddhism, Tantrism, Oriental alchemy, mystical erotism, and shamanism.

"Mircea Eliade (1907-1986) was a historian of religions, phenomenologist of religion, and author of novels, novellas, and short stories. Eliade was one of the most influential scholars of religion of the 20th century and one of the worldâ s foremost interpreters of religious symbolism and myth." -Britannica.

The tradition of yoga is treated with exceptional directness and detail in this volume. Its authority derives from the author's years of study and his experience gained in various ashrams and universities in India. Subjects discussed include the Y oga~sutras and Patafijali; yogic techniques ( e.g., concentration "on a Single Point," postures, respiratory discipline); and Yoga in relation to Brahmanism, Buddhism, Tantrism, Oriental alchemy, mystical erotism, and shamanism. "One of the most important and exhaustive single~volume studies of the major ascetic techniques of India and their history yet to appear in English . a welcome and major addition to a fuller understanding of the philosophical East."~San Francisco Chronicle. "No explorer has ever presented a wider survey of the various phases of yoga or drawn a more stimulating interpretation of its meaning."~Masatoshi Nagatomi, Harvard Journal of Asiatic Studies.
